Nationals' Guzman to have shoulder scoped

Sports Network | October 8, 2009

Washington, DC (Sports Network) - Washington Nationals shortstop Cristian Guzman will have arthroscpic surgery on his right shoulder on Thursday at The Washington Hospital Center.

Guzman was bothered by shoulder problems for the final month of the season and was relegated to pinch-hitting duties because of his inability to play the field.

In 135 games for the Nationals this season, Guzman batted .284 with six home runs and 52 runs batted in.
